Hi happyone2009,
I like you choice of colour for the exterior of the house. Very cheery. Your use of moveObjects to place the picnic table allows for large parties. I would have placed the picnic basket on the picnic table though instead of on the ground. Just one note to you though, I almost missed the picnic table beacuse it blends in so well with the deck.
The archetecture is nicely laid out and as I've said before I think ceilings are a must. Magician noted the different wallcoverings on the peaks and it was especially noticable in "cameraman mode" while touring the house.
Entering the living room I see a lovely shade of green, a very pleasing colour. I think, however, possibly a pattern on the sofa in the same shade would add a little more interest to the room. I think curtains would add a little dimention to the room as well. I also noticed on one side of the room you have used the very modern 'Funshine Wall Lamp', on the other sie of the room you have used the 'Far Out Wall Sconce' and on the ceiling the 'Lucid Light'. Also one of the sconces is on a door. Oops. I like your use of moveObjects for the furniture placement in this room.
The kitchen is very nicely done and the colours work well together. The flow is good.
I also think glass doors to a bedroom would probably not be appreciated by you're amourous sims.
In the bathroom again you have two different types of lights. I love the floor tile in the little pink half bathroom, but both could use a little decor. Maybe just a towel rack, toilet paper roll and a picture on the wall.
In the gym the picture frames can be CAS'd to matching colours. Maybe a little colour on the picture frames and colourful curtains would make the room pop a bit more.
In the study the problem with the non working computer was easity rectified by moving the desk over a little using the alt key and placing the chair in it's proper place. A very nice peacefule place to study.
The nursery, however, is just too adorable. I love it. I hope it's a girl.
